Job Overview
The role is responsible for managing end-to-end time and attendance operations in the plant, ensuring data accuracy, compliance, and readiness for payroll processing. The role also drives attendance process improvement and supports system optimization.
Job Requirements
- Daily Attendance Operations
- Maintain accurate daily attendance records including clock-in/out, shift, leave, and absence
- Perform daily data monitoring to ensure completeness and timely updates in the system
- Track attendance cut-off timelines and ensure data readiness before monthly closing
- Shift & OT Management
- Maintain and update shift rosters based on production requirements
- Coordinate with production supervisors on shift changes and adjustments
- Track, validate, and reconcile overtime records in alignment with company policy
- Ensure proper capture of overtime and shift changes to avoid payroll discrepancies
- Attendance Exception Handling
- Identify attendance irregularities such as missing punches, incorrect shifts, and abnormal hours
- Follow up with employees and supervisors for correction and approval
- Ensure all attendance exceptions are resolved prior to payroll cut-off
- Data Validation & Quality Control
- Conduct weekly/monthly attendance reconciliation to ensure data accuracy
- Cross-check attendance data against leave records, shift plans, and OT submissions
- Support audit checks and ensure traceability of attendance adjustments
- Promote timely attendance verification by employees and departments to reduce errors
- Employee & Operations Support
- Respond to employee queries related to attendance, leave, and overtime
- Provide guidance on attendance policies and procedures
- Support supervisors in ensuring team attendance compliance
- Generate regular attendance reports for HR and operations review
- Support system data accuracy and continuous improvement initiative
- Payroll Support
- Provide attendance data for payroll calculation
- Support payroll input collection and checks
- Process Management
- Establish and ensure standardized attendance processes aligned with company policies and compliance requirements
- Implement structured working routines (daily monitoring, periodic reconciliation, cut-off control) to ensure effective operations
- Drive proactive issue identification and resolution to minimize payroll impact
- Identify improvement opportunities and drive enhancements to improve data quality and operational efficiency
